§ 15-7-407 — Consumer rates; depreciation

Wyoming·Title 15 Cities and Towns·Ch. 7 PUBLIC IMPROVEMENTS·Art. 4 BOARD OF PUBLIC UTILITIES
(a)The board shall fix the rates for water, sanitary sewer services and electric service furnished to customers, and any revision thereof is subject to the local governing body's review, modification and approval. The rates shall secure an income sufficient to:
(i)Pay the interest charges and principal payments on all bonds issued to pay the purchase price, construction cost, extensions and enlargements of the respective systems as they are due;
(ii)Pay all salaries and wages of the officers and employees;
(iii)Cover the cost of all materials and supplies used in the operation of the plants;
(iv)Cover all miscellaneous expenses;
(v)Cover all usual extensions and enlargements, together with a reasonable allowance for emergency and unforeseen expenses; and
